Applications Manager

Ogletree DeakinsAtlanta, GA

About The Position

Ogletree Deakins has the opportunity for an Applications Manager to join our Information Technology department. The Applications Manager is responsible for overseeing the implementation, support, and strategic optimization of business applications within the organization. A core aspect of this role is to enhance and continually optimize the user experience, ensuring that software solutions are intuitive, efficient, and aligned with business objectives. This role blends portfolio leadership, application lifecycle governance, delivery oversight, and stakeholder engagement to ensure that systems remain reliable, secure, scalable, and aligned to the firm’s business objectives. The Application Manager’s team plays a critical role in supporting the firm’s enterprise applications, including iManage Document and Records Management systems, Aderant financial systems, Interaction (CRM), UKG/Ultipro HRIS, and many others. The Application Manager will work closely with related teams to ensure optimal system configuration and performance, upgrade and modernize applications, support cloud migration where appropriate, and align feature adoption with business requirements. In addition, the Applications team will support the many data integrations that exist among these enterprise systems, assist with troubleshooting, and collaborate with the Endpoint packaging team on client deployments. This position will accomplish these objectives through hands-on execution while also coordinating, overseeing, and delegating to Technology department resources as well as external vendors, contractors, and consultants. This position will act as project manager for some related activities, while also working with dedicated project managers on larger projects as needed.

Requirements

  • Four-year degree in computer science, computer engineering, information technology, or related fields of study or equivalent experience.
  • 10+ years of progressive experience working with enterprise software and services
  • 3+ years as a supervisor/manager of a technical team.
  • Strong knowledge of enterprise Document Management, Finance, HR, Marketing, and related systems.
  • Strong understanding of enterprise application architectures, databases, integration technologies, and application lifecycle management.
  • Experience with cloud-based platforms (iManage Cloud, UKG, SaaS ecosystems, Azure).
  • Demonstrate leadership experience supporting legal industry applications or working in a law-firm environment required.
  • Exceptional communication, relationship building, and stakeholder management abilities.
  • Strategic thinker with analytical problem-solving abilities and attention to detail.
  • Proven ability to manage multiple priorities while maintaining delivery focus and quality.
  • Proven success overseeing complex, multi-system environments and cross-functional delivery teams.
  • Routine engagement with change management, IT governance, and implementation of security standards.
  • Proficiency with ITIL or service management frameworks.
  • Experience managing vendor relationships, consultants, and service level agreements related to business applications.

Nice To Haves

  • Familiarity with leading legal applications including iManage DMS, Aderant financial systems, Aderant vi people management, Interaction, Foundation, and Intapp systems preferred.

Responsibilities

  • Establish ownership over a portfolio of key enterprise applications. Partner with other teams outside of IT to ensure proper operation, maintenance and lifecycle management of additional enterprise platforms.
  • Lead the selection, deployment, management, and continuous optimization of business applications, with a strong focus on improving end-user experience and aligning with organizational goals.
  • Lead team initiatives to monitor, troubleshoot, support, document, and maintain all required systems. Perform systems administration functions for in-house, cloud-based, or custom solutions including addressing day-to-day runtime issues, regular upgrades/patching, and testing. Ensure 24x7 high availability, performance, and sufficient capacity for efficient day-to-day operations.
  • Develop and maintain a roadmap for system upgrades, adoption of new features, replacement of related servers, and cloud migration where possible. Meet regularly with vendors and internal system owners to stay abreast of new features, plan upgrades and adoption strategies, understand client upgrade requirements, and evaluate licensing changes.
  • Communicate effectively with non-technical customers and sponsors. Collaborate with business units to gather requirements, recommend solutions, and deliver enhancements or new applications that optimize usability and efficiency.
  • Evaluate and recommend steps required to upgrade/replace/migrate enterprise systems, coordinating the development and execution of complex project plans as needed.
  • Assist in implementing disaster recovery and business continuity plans for enterprise applications.
  • Stay current with industry trends and emerging technologies to recommend innovative solutions that elevate the user experience. Continuously develop technical and professional skills.

Benefits

  • Paid Time Off
  • Paid Sick Leave
  • a 401(k) matching program
  • Profit Sharing
  • Paid Holidays
  • Paid Parental Leave
  • affordable Health and Life Insurance including Dental & Vision coverage
  • Health Savings Account /Flexible Spending Accounts to help offset the cost of dependent care and/or health care expenses
  • Tuition Reimbursement
  • Employee Assistance Program
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service